Today, I want to share a powerful concept that I was studying last week. Often times the thing that holds us back the most is ourselves. We are often our greatest obstacle to success. It is so important to constantly be developing oneself as a person. Read and listen to the personal growth coaches, and that will directly impact your business. In the book, Cash in a Flash, by Robert Allen and Mark Victor Hansen they discuss the power of the words we speak to ourselves and out load. Do you use positive or negative words and language? The words you choose can enable or disable you. They can energize or weaken you. They can take you to great heights or keep you in dark valleys.

They shared an exercise that I have found to be very powerful. I remember we did this exercise with my soccer team when they were 11 years old. Every time one of the kids made a mistake and started to get upset at themselves another player or one of the coaches would say CANCEL. It was amazing the impact it made over the season. This exercise is very similar. I want you to really listen to what you are saying to yourself and how you are speaking. Every time you hear yourself thinking or speaking a negative thought say SWITCH. 

And, then replace it with a positive thought. I am not saying that bad things don't happen, but I am saying that there is positive and good things in almost everything.

Multiple Streams of Income - Part 2

Last week we discussed creating multiple streams of income/revenue for you and your business. And, ultimately we want to create passive streams of income. The first stage of wealth building is to create a passive income stream that will cover all your expenses. Think about this for a minute. So often I have read books on buying property, shares, assets, or paying down debt, or increasing my income; but the first step to wealth creation is creating a passive income that will cover all your expenses. When you have done this, then you are in a position to accelerate your wealth creation. Whether you work or not, all your expenses are covered.
So, how can we create passive income streams, and really what is a passive income stream. The crux of passive income stream is that you make something once that you can sell once and get paid over and over again for the one effort. Most people have a product or service that you are required to continually resale to get paid so if they don't work they don't get paid. Are you in that situation? Here are a few ideas that lead to passive income:
  • Write a book, audio recording, or video recording. (Create it once, find a vehicle to sell it and get paid for the one effort over and over again.)
  • Build your business around a system, and then franchise it. (The initial franchise fees and the ongoing fees are an incredible source of passive income.)
  • Direct sales or network marketing. (I know this may have a bad rap, but with the right research this is a legitimate way of creating an incredible passive income for the right person.)
  • Products that are consumable and need to be purchased over and over again.
  • Internet businesses that resale information. (Discover a niche that is underserviced, set up a website correctly, and you can create a cash cow.)
  • Membership based services.
  • Build a large sales team that you override a small percentage on the production. (Key point here is that they should not be salary based because this can kill your cashflow. Let the team get the lion's share of commission, and you take a overriding percentage for the training and support you provide.)
There are so many other ways to achieve a passive income. These are just a few to spark your creative juices. I have learned over the years that this is the most crucial step in creating a stable business. Create multiple streams of revenue

The weather in Grapevine is incredible after an entire summer of 100+, isn't it? I am loving it. I want share with you an important component to building a successful business, but I want to start with two questions. 
  • How many income buckets do you have? Do you have 1, 2, 3 or 10? This is an incredibly important question to ask yourself.
  • And, do your income buckets require active selling to generate any revenue?
It is an important component of business for you to have multiple streams of income or multiple buckets, and some of those buckets need to generate income residually.
